*How can we prepare today for the Savior's Second Coming?
- Now is the time to repent and prepare. Elder Klebingat, Oct 2014 general conference, asks: "On a scale of 1 to 10, how would you rate your spiritual confidence before God? Do you have a personal witness that your current offering as a Latter-day Saint is sufficient to inherit eternal life? Can you say within yourself that Heavenly Father is pleased with you? Six practical suggestions by Elder Klebingat: 1) Take responsibility for your own spiritual well-being. 2) Take responsibility for your own physical well-being. 3) Embrace wholehearted obedience as part of your life. 4) Become really good at repenting thoroughly and quickly. 5) Become good at forgiving. 6) Accept trials, setbacks, and surprises as part of your mortal experience and learn from them.
